Morocco - Export of Sparkling Grape Wines
Since 2014, Morocco Export of Sparkling Grape Wines increased 183.2% year on year. With $122,276.74 in 2019, the country was number 72 among other countries in Export of Sparkling Grape Wines. Morocco is overtaken by Barbados, which was ranked number 71 at $142,874 and is followed by Suriname with $122,160.13. France lead the ranking with $3,792,400,186.88 in 2019, that is an increase of 0.1% versus 2018. Italy, Spain and Singapore resp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ghana witnessed the best average annual growth at +227.1% per year, while Zambia recorded the worst performance at -72.8% per year.
